Here's a bit of fascinating research to help understand a bit more of Chaisen's backstory as we start wrapping up Season 2. Millions of people from all walks of life, all ages, all faiths, all languages, non-faiths, and all backgrounds, have had a Near Death Experience (NDE). Almost all of them come back, regardless of any prior belief, with the same shared understanding: Death is not to be feared, love and compassion matters more, and life feels like it has a mission.

*"Research suggests children are more likely to experience or report a Near-Death Experience (NDE) than adults, particularly in cases of cardiac arrest. Where children and near-death experiences are concerned specifically, common changes (when they return) include:

•Increased interest in “universal love” rather than love of specific people

•Heightened distress from news media and popular media, including news reports and from violence in TV shows, movies, and video games

•Increased interest in being of service to others, and / or a strong desire to volunteer for charitable causes. Often includes increased sensitivity to others’ feelings

•A heightened hunger for knowledge, particularly with regards to philosophy, which can lead to unusual reading material choices for people their age"

*Source: iands.org/support/children-and-near-death-experien…
